Rainbow Falafel with Pickled Turnips
These falafel are a colorful and fragrant twist on the Middle Eastern staple. Unlike traditional falafel, these are baked and contain different vegetables, taking on their colors, flavors and nutrients. Beet-pickled turnips make a great topping for this dish but can be served on many other sandwiches and salads.

Falafel Tacos with Spiced Citrus Crema
In this fun Middle Eastern-meets-Mexican gluten-free dish, Silvana Nardone serves falafel in corn tortillas with sour cream that she doctors with citrus juices as well as cumin and fennel.

Spring Pea Falafel with Marinated Radishes and Minted Yogurt
Instead of deep-frying the falafel patties, Nicki Reiss sautes them in a lightly oiled pan. And she serves them with a low-fat yogurt sauce instead of the usual rich sesame-based tahini.

Snap Pea Falafel Salad
F&W's Kay Chun riffs on falafel here, creating a delicious salad with chickpeas, snap peas, bulgur and tomatoes.
